Regular Maintenance Schedules
A well-planned maintenance schedule is crucial to prevent commercial refrigeration system breakdowns. Here are some key aspects to consider:
- Monthly inspections: Regularly inspect your commercial refrigeration systems for signs of wear and tear, including leaks, loose connections, and unusual noises. Make sure to check the condenser coils, evaporator coils, and fan motors.
- Quarterly cleaning: Clean the condenser coils, evaporator coils, and drain pans to ensure optimal airflow and moisture removal.
- Semi-annual maintenance: Perform semi-annual maintenance tasks, such as checking refrigerant levels, monitoring system pressures, and inspecting drain lines.
- Annual inspections: Have a professional inspect your commercial refrigeration systems to identify any potential issues before they become major problems.
Inspecting and Identifying Potential Issues
Identifying potential issues early on can help prevent commercial refrigeration system breakdowns. Here are some tips to help you inspect and identify potential issues:
- Monitor temperature controls: Regularly check temperature controls to ensure they are functioning correctly. If you notice any temperature fluctuations, investigate the cause and address it promptly.
- Check refrigerant levels: Monitor refrigerant levels and recharge the system as needed. Low refrigerant levels can cause the system to work harder, leading to increased energy consumption and reduced lifespan.
- Inspect electrical connections: Check electrical connections for signs of wear and damage. Loose or damaged connections can cause system failures and pose fire hazards.
- Look for unusual noises: Listen for unusual noises, such as hissing sounds, clanking noises, or vibrations. These can indicate potential issues with the system, including refrigerant leaks, worn-out parts, or loose connections.

Risks Associated with Gas Leaks and Electrical Shock
Gas leaks and electrical shock are two of the most significant hazards associated with commercial refrigeration repair. Gas leaks can occur when there is a leak in the refrigeration system, releasing hazardous gases such as ammonia, carbon dioxide, or hydrofluorocarbons (HFCs) into the air. These gases can cause respiratory problems, eye irritation, and other health issues.
Electrical shock, on the other hand, can occur when there is a fault in the electrical wiring or components of the refrigeration system. This can cause a sudden release of electrical energy, which can be fatal.
To prevent these hazards, technicians must be aware of the potential risks and take necessary precautions, such as:
* Checking the refrigeration system for leaks before starting work
* Using personal gas detectors to monitor the air for hazardous gases
* Inspecting electrical components and wiring for signs of damage or wear
* Using insulated tools and avoiding contact with electrical components
* Ensuring that the work area is well-ventilated and free from flammable materials
By taking these precautions, technicians can reduce the risk of accidents and injuries when working with commercial refrigeration systems.

Refrigerant Emissions and Their Environmental Impact
Refrigerants are substances used in commercial refrigeration systems to transfer heat from the inside of the system to the outside, thereby cooling the contents. However, some refrigerants, such as chlorofluorocarbons (CFCs) and hydrochlorofluorocarbons (HCFCs), are potent greenhouse gases, contributing to climate change.
- The release of CFCs and HCFCs into the atmosphere leads to the depletion of the ozone layer, allowing harmful ultraviolet (UV) radiation to reach the Earth’s surface.
- These refrigerants also have a high global warming potential (GWP), meaning they trap heat in the atmosphere and contribute to climate change.
Importance of Proper Disposal and Recycling Procedures
The environmental impact of commercial refrigeration systems can be minimized by implementing proper disposal and recycling procedures for refrigerants. This includes:
- Proper handling and storage of refrigerants during maintenance and repair tasks to prevent accidental release.
- Disposal of refrigerants through certified facilities that follow strict guidelines to minimize environmental contamination.
- Reuse or recycling of refrigerants in accordance with relevant regulations and industry standards.

Routine Maintenance and Inspection
Regular maintenance and inspection of commercial refrigeration systems is essential to prevent system failures and minimize environmental impact. Some routine tasks include:
| Task | Description |
|---|---|
| Leak detection | Detect and repair any refrigerant leaks to prevent release into the atmosphere. |
| Cleanliness checking | Regularly inspect the system’s cleanliness and remove any dirt, dust, or debris that may obstruct airflow or refrigerant flow. |
| Temperature monitoring | Monitor system temperatures to ensure they are within optimal ranges, preventing overheating or undercooling. |
